The street in brief

Marilyn Crescent is almost entirely semi-detached houses. Homes here typically change hands around £182,500 — roughly 41% below the CT7 norm. On floor area that works out near £4,897 per square metre, above the district's £3,659. Too few recent sales to read a street-level trend, but across CT7 prices have been easing over the last few years. With 15 sales across 12 homes since 2002, homes here come to market only rarely.

Marilyn Crescent's £182,500 median sits about 41% below CT7's £310,000; on floor space it runs £4,897/m² against the district's £3,659/m² (+34%).

Street and CT7 figures are medians of HM Land Registry sales; the England figures are the UK House Price Index mix-adjusted average — a different basis, so compare direction rather than levels between the two.
